Donald Trump will meet today with senior officials, including Secretary of State Marco Rubio and Secretary of Defense Pete Hegeseth, to assess and take several steps on Ukraine, including suspending or canceling military aid to Ukraine .

Also under scrutiny are the latest shipments of ammunition and equipment already authorized and paid for during the Joe Biden administration .

The news was reported by the New York Times, citing anonymous officials of the US administration.

The rare earths deal, however, is no longer on the table . This was stated by Treasury Secretary Scott Bessent in an interview with CBS News on the program “Face the Nation”.

“All President Zelensky had to do was come in and sign this economic agreement, and again show no divergence — no divergence — between the Ukrainian people and the American people, and he chose to blow it ,” Bessent said. The US Treasury Secretary stressed that it is “impossible to have an economic agreement without a peace agreement.”

Zelensky , for his part, speaking to reporters at London's Stansted Airport, said that to end the war with Russia "there is still a long way to go." He reiterated that any agreement would have to be "honest, fair and stable, with very specific security guarantees."

Concessions to Moscow? "Today there is no talk of it, it would be wrong. We will never recognize the occupied territories as Russian territory. For us, these will be temporary occupations."

The Ukrainian leader also reiterated that he was " ready to resign for Ukraine's accession to NATO" . Because "then it would mean that I have fulfilled my mission. However, I would run again ".

Kremlin spokesman Dmitry Peskov responded to Zelensky's words: " The Ukrainian president does not want peace, someone must force him to want it , it is very important that someone forces him to change his position."
